Title:
BOTTLE CAN MADE OF METAL

Abstract:

To provide a bottle can having a good opening torque and being capable of reliably obtaining corrosion resistance at a threaded portion in spite of using ink containing foamable microcapsules.

The ink 21 that contains the foamable microcapsules 22 is applied on the portions except the threaded portion 14 on the surface of the can base substrate. For example, the ink is applied to a portion below the threaded portion 14. The foamable microcapsules 22 contained in the ink 21 has gas or low-boiling point liquid sealed therein, and are spherules that have properties of foaming their volumes when they are heated. Since the foamable microcapsules 22 obtain diffuseness of light by being heated, the surface of the base substrate can have an excellent matted pattern. After the ink 21 is applied, an over varnish 23 is applied thereon.
